Is Big Marijuana a Good Thing?

Mark Kleiman, a Professor of Public Policy and Director of the Crime Reduction and Justice Initiative at New York University’s Marron Institute, was quoted in a Quartz article titled: "Temptation Goods: America’s weed industry is going to be massive. Is Big Marijuana a good thing?". 

Kleiman was the chair at the Cannabis Science and Policy Summit, at which cannabis legalization advocates, public health researchers, state regulators, and investors hoping to take advantage of the anticipated cannabis boom discussed the implication of national cannabis legalization. The conference was hosted by the Marron Institute, and sponsored by The International Society for the Study of Drug Policy (ISSDP) and RAND Drug Policy Research Center.

On the topic of cannabis policy, Kleiman commented: 

“The simple choice between prohibition and legalization does not exhaust the policy space...Varieties of legalization can be more or less effective in getting rid of the harms of prohibition, and more or less cautious with respect to the possible harms from increased access.”
